As the basketball season comes to a close at Heritage High School, players reflect on their successful run, with varsity taking nine wins and junior varsity landing three. The players express gratitude for the supportive community surrounding the sport, highlighting the connections and friendships it fosters. Despite the season ending, athletes like Kendall Cutright are determined to return even stronger, emphasizing the importance of continuous practice and improvement.
